Understanding the Role of an Educational Research Analyst
An Educational Research Analyst is a specialist who collects, analyzes, and interprets data to support decision-making and continuous enhancement in educational settings. Working within universities, colleges, or schools, these professionals bridge the gap between educational goals and evidence-based strategies, driving innovation through research and technology.
Main Responsibilities
- Data Collection & Management: Gathering quantitative and qualitative data through surveys, interviews, classroom observations, and educational databases.
- Statistical Analysis: Utilizing statistical methods and software tools to interpret assessment results,student performance data,and other metrics.
- Reporting & Presentation: Communicating research findings to administrators, faculty, and other stakeholders through clear reports, presentations, and interactive dashboards.
- Program Evaluation: Measuring the impact and effectiveness of various educational programs, tools, and teaching interventions.
- Technology Integration: Recommending and testing edtech solutions that address educational challenges and support digital transformation.
- Policy Analysis: Investigating and interpreting relevant educational laws, guidelines, and institutional policies to inform decision-making.
Key Skills Required for Educational Research Analysts
Succeeding as an Educational Research Analyst in higher education or schools requires a blend of analytical expertise, technical proficiency, and strong communication skills. Here are the core competencies you’ll need:
- Research Methodology: Deep understanding of quantitative and qualitative research practices, including sampling, survey design, and experimental methods.
- Statistical Analysis: Proficiency in data analysis software such as SPSS, R, python, or SAS. Ability to interpret statistical findings and translate them into actionable insights.
- Educational Assessment: Familiarity with standardized testing, formative and summative assessments, and learning analytics tools.
- EdTech Literacy: Knowledge of top education technology platforms, data management systems, and digital learning trends.
- Critical Thinking: Ability to scrutinize sources, identify patterns, troubleshoot anomalies, and challenge assumptions.
- report Writing & Communication: Skill in creating concise reports, policy briefs, and visual data presentations for diverse audiences.
- Project management: organizational skills to manage multiple projects,timelines,and stakeholders in a fast-paced academic surroundings.
- Collaboration: Capacity to work effectively with faculty, administrators, IT professionals, and external research partners.
Career opportunities for Educational Research Analysts
The demand for Educational Research Analysts is surging in response to the increased reliance on data-driven decision-making in education.Here’s where you can apply your expertise:
A. Universities and Colleges
- Institutional Research Office: Support strategic planning, accreditation reports, and program evaluations.
- Academic Departments: Collaborate on curriculum innovations, learning analytics, and assessment projects.
- EdTech Centers: Contribute to the progress, adoption, and evaluation of digital learning tools and online instruction.
B. K-12 schools and School Districts
- Assessment Coordinator: Oversee student testing programs and analyze achievement data.
- Program Evaluator: Measure outcomes related to intervention programs, technology adoption, and instructional strategies.
- Data Analyst: Monitor attendance, graduation rates, and other key performance indicators for school improvement.
C.Education Technology Companies
- product Research: Aid in the development, user testing, and refinement of educational software and platforms.
- Customer Success: Guide clients in interpreting data from educational tools and optimizing product usage.
- Market Research: Analyze trends to inform product development and strategy in the edtech sector.
D. Research Institutes and Policy Organizations
- Policy Analyst: Study educational policies, funding models, and best practices to support advocacy and reform.
- Grant Researcher: Design studies that attract funding for innovative educational initiatives.

Practical Tips to Launch Your Career in Education Technology
Breaking into the role of Educational Research Analyst in universities, colleges, or schools requires strategic preparation and proactive networking. Here’s how you can enhance your prospects:
1. build Relevant Academic Credentials
- Pursue degrees in fields like Education, Psychology, Statistics, Data Science, or Educational Technology.
- Consider certification programs in research methods or specific software tools (SPSS, R, Python).
2. Gain Hands-On Experience
- Intern or volunteer in a research office,education technology company,or school district.
- Contribute to open-source edtech projects or educational research studies.
3. Develop Technical Competency
- Master statistical analysis software and data visualization tools (Tableau, power BI).
- Stay informed about the latest trends and innovations in education technology.
4. Strengthen Communication Skills
- Practise translating complex data into actionable recommendations for non-technical audiences.
- present your research at education conferences, webinars, or online communities.
5.Network and Stay Connected
- Join professional associations such as the American Educational Research Association (AERA).
- Engage with peers in education forums, LinkedIn groups, or community meetups focused on edtech.
